What is the dojo?

The dojo is a place to bring challenges and get support from peers in figuring out a path forward.
Examples of recent challenges: how to test an assumption; how to persuade stakeholders; how to decide where to draw the line on an MVP; managing change.

​

There are no obligations other than showing up, bringing your challenges, and being ready to support others in theirs!

​

Why is the dojo?

Because product in nonprofit is fairly nascent,

  • many product managers are the only face of product in their organization, and don't have peer support internally;

  • the product craft training and personal development fostered in traditional tech companies aren't common in product;

  • the practices that create strong product solutions are unfamiliar and often counterintuitive in nonprofit environments; 

  • there are different pressures and incentives in nonprofit compared to traditional tech, so traditional product resources can be hard to translate.

​

As a result, there's a strong sense of isolation for practitioners in the sector, and a hunger to learn from others' experiences.

 

The Dojo is a way to connect and grow this community!
